Job Description

• Build Core Platform Features: Develop backend services, APIs, and user-facing features across the platform. You'll work on everything from symptom tracking to lab result visualization to treatment recommendations. • Integrate Data Sources: Build integrations with wearables (Oura, Apple Health, Whoop, Garmin), lab providers, and other health data sources. Create pipelines that ingest, normalize, and store data reliably. • Contribute to AI/ML Systems: Work alongside senior engineers to build and improve our health intelligence engine—including conversational AI, recommendation models, and pattern detection. Prior ML exposure is helpful; willingness to learn is essential. • Ship Fast and Iterate: We're early stage. You'll ship code frequently, get feedback from real users, and iterate quickly. Comfort with ambiguity and a bias toward action are key. • Build with AI-Native Tools: Use Claude, Claude Code, Cursor, and other AI-assisted development tools daily. We embrace vibe coding and expect you to leverage AI to move faster and learn faster. • Learn the Healthcare Domain: You'll pick up health data concepts, compliance basics (HIPAA), and clinical terminology as you go. We'll support your learning—curiosity matters more than prior experience here.
